Lemon, Garlic & Bean Salad

A superbly simple salad with a garlic and lemon dressing.

Lemon, Garlic & Bean Salad
number of serves  serves 4
prep time 10 min prep

ingredients

1 x 420g can Edgell Four Bean Mix, drained
2 cups baby spinach leaves

Dressing:
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 teaspoon grated lemon rind
1 clove garlic, peeled and crushed
Juice of half lemon (approximately 1 tablespoon)
1 tablespoon chopped parsley

instructions

step 1

Place drained Edgell Four Bean Mix and baby spinach leaves into a large bowl.

step 2

Combine dressing ingredients, pour over salad mixture and gently toss together. Serve as an accompaniment for barbecues or as a quick summer salad.

recipe tip

Use the recipe above as a base salad and simply add to it any of the following ingredients: diced fetta cheese, sliced olives, chopped semi sun-dried tomatoes or diced cucumber.

nutritional information

Qty per serving QTY PER 100g
Energy 670kJ (160Cal) 696kJ (166Cal)
Protein 5.3g 5.5g
Fat- Total 9.6g 10.0g
     - Saturated 1.4g 1.4g
Carbohydrate 10.4g 10.8g
     - Sugars 1.6g 1.7g
Dietary Fibre 5.7g 5.9g
Sodium 161mg 167mg
Potassium 298mg 309mg
